A huge thank you to Ryan Cordaro '20 for stopping by Upper Campus on Wednesday morning and speaking to our 11th and 12th grade students. Joined by Upper School Music Teacher Stafford Merk, Cordaro spoke about his time at Lawrence, experiences in postsecondary classrooms, the importance of self-advocacy, and much more.
During his time at Lawrence, Ryan was an active member of our community, participating in the choir, the spring musical (where he played Shrek in his senior year), the winter play, bowling club, and serving as a student ambassador, in addition to being an annual performer at the Coffeehouse. Upon graduation, he continued his journey downtown at Cleveland State University, where he earned his Bachelor of Science degree in Film Studies in December 2024.
Today, Ryan contributes to the "Guy At The Movies" blog, critiques films, has served as a film judge at the Eerie Horror Fest, writes short films, and works part-time, while currently looking into applying to pursue his master’s degree.We're incredibly proud of Ryan and all he's accomplished!
